What is Everglades Boats?

Everglades Boats are a renowned brand of premium, high-performance recreational and fishing boats, known for their innovative design and superior construction. Founded in 2001, the company is headquartered in Florida and offers a range of models including center consoles, dual consoles, and bay boats. Everglades Boats are recognized for their patented Rapid Molded Core Assembly Process (RAMCAP), which enhances durability and safety. These boats are popular among serious anglers and boating enthusiasts for their quality, reliability, and advanced features.

Job Description

We’re seeking the right team member to create new tooling from engineering design, prints and work instructions for our premium offshore fishing boats. This team member will be involved in every aspect of the process and will assist in the operation of cutting parts on the CNC router by accurately reading engineering prints to accurately build the patterns and plugs. This person will complete flange trimming, grind prepping, tabbing framework, parting molds and will apply a variety of release agents, gelcoats, resins, and fiberglass to patterns, plugs, molds and glass masters.
